## Tuning

`tailwisp` reads rotating log files over SSH and follows rotation automatically. Defaults work for most Greybarrow services; you usually only adjust them when tailing very chatty logs or slow links. Larger buffers reduce syscalls but delay output; shorter poll intervals burn CPU on the jump host. Start with the defaults before touching anything. The tunable constants are listed below.

tuning constants:
QUOTAS = {
    "druwyn": 5,
    "holix": 5,
    "zorath": 5,
    "holwyn": 10,
}

Subject: Partner SFTP drop — new owner

Hi,

As you review the pending changes to the Harborline ingest scripts, note that ownership of the partner SFTP drop is changing at the end of the month. This includes key rotation, the nightly pull job, and the quarantine folder for malformed files. Review comments on the retry logic should still go through the normal PR flow, but questions about drop-folder conventions or partner onboarding now go to the new owner. The incoming owner is listed below.

signatory, tagaf-bahaf: Praael Fenmir Rusok

Runbook: Tilegrove Cache Layer

Scope for review: the tile-rendering cache fronting the Maplode renderer. Eviction is LRU, 12h TTL, keyed by zoom/x/y plus style hash. Cache nodes hold no customer data; only rendered rasters. Purge endpoint requires the shared cache token. Confirm TLS between renderer and cache. The token is set in cache.env, on the line that follows this sentence.

env line for fafof-fahag: LEDGER_TOKEN5=f8790